Latest Patents

Staffan Bengtsson holds a patent for a "Method and device for PD cyclers - PD-cycler and tube set therefor and a method for use thereof." This invention includes a tube set that features a transfer member designed for the automatic transfer of any remaining contents in supply bags or heater bags to a waste receiver. Additionally, the device incorporates a separate connection unit linked to a valve pack of the PD-cycler. This connection unit contains a rod made of ferromagnetic material, which provides an indication that the tube set is correctly positioned. The design also combines beater and drain bags into a double bag, supported by a yoke in a folded state, which unfolds upon application into the PD-cycler.

Career Highlights

Staffan Bengtsson is associated with Gambro Lundia AB, a company known for its advancements in medical technology. His work has contributed to improving patient care and the efficiency of dialysis treatments.

Collaborations

Throughout his career, Staffan has collaborated with talented individuals such as Jan-Bertil Jeppsson and Mikael Axelsson. These partnerships have fostered innovation and have been instrumental in the development of his patented technologies.
